Rory Keene and Josh Normanton succeeded in the defence of a licensed accountant who was accused of fraudulent trading connected with the business activities of her accountancy firm.

The alleged fraudulent activity related both to fraudulent misrepresentations to trainees of the firm and the firm’s conduct with respect to its accountancy clients. Their client who was prosecuted by City of London Trading Standards was acquitted on all counts. She was tried alongside another director who was convicted. The trial lasted 4 weeks before HHJ Hillen QC at Prospero House (the “nightingale court” at Southwark Crown Court).
